Jokes That Offer Both Hilarious and Valuable Life Lessons

Buckle up, folks! We’re about to embark on a laugh-filled journey that might just teach you a thing or two. These jokes aren’t just your average knee-slappers—they’re packed with wisdom that’ll make you chuckle and think.

Life has a funny way of teaching us lessons, doesn’t it? Sometimes it’s through heartbreak, sometimes through triumph, and sometimes—just sometimes—it’s through a well-timed joke that makes you spit out your coffee.

Take the woman who answered the door in a towel only to find her neighbor offering $800 if she dropped it. Temptation won, and she took the cash. But when her husband later asked if the neighbor had said anything about the $800 he owed him, the lesson was clear: always know the full details of a deal before you strip it down.

Or the three office workers who stumbled across a genie. The clerk wished for the Bahamas, the sales rep for Hawaii, and both vanished in a puff of smoke. But when the manager made his wish, he simply asked for them back in the office after lunch. Sometimes it pays to let the boss go first.

Then there’s the priest and the nun. A glance, a touch, and a reminder from the nun to remember Psalm 129. Later, when the priest checked the verse, it read, “Go forth and seek, further up, you will find glory.” The moral? If you’re not well informed, you might just miss out on a golden opportunity.

In another tale, a crow perched high in a tree doing nothing inspired a rabbit to follow suit. Unfortunately, while the crow was safe up high, the rabbit was quickly eaten by a fox. To do nothing safely, you’d better be sitting at the top.

Similarly, a turkey with big dreams nibbled on a bull’s droppings for strength and climbed higher each day until he reached the top of a tree. But his glory didn’t last—he was spotted and shot by a farmer. Success built on waste never lasts.

And finally, the little bird who froze in the cold was saved by a cow’s dung. As the warmth brought him back to life, he sang joyfully—only to be eaten by a passing cat. The lesson? Not everyone who gets you out of a mess is your friend, and not everyone who dumps on you is your enemy.
